冷适应微生物的研究现状与应用前景 被引量:4

The Research Status and Application Prospect of Cold-adapted Microorganism

摘要 目的:探讨冷适应微生物研究现状及未来的应用前景。方法:收集有关冷适应微生物的国内外近期研究资料并加以综合归纳。结果:近年来国内外对冷适应微生物的冷适应机制研究和应用范围的拓展均取得了可喜成绩。结论:对冷适应微生物的深入研究具有重要的理论意义和工业应用价值,前景诱人。 Objective: To discuss the research status and application prospect of cold-adapted microorganism. Methods: Collecting and summarizing domestic and foreign data concerned recently. Results: Great progress has been made on the research and application cold-adapted mechanisms and cold-adapted microorganism both at home and abroad in recent years. Conclusion: Researching cold-adapted microorganism takes on significant value for theory research and application in industry. And it shows brighter application prospects in industry.
